Monday, June 01, 2009

Bess answered the Brennans' door to Brody and calmly informed him that no one is going to take baby Chloe away from her. He grabbed Bess in an effort to get through to Jessica, but Mr. Brennan approached with a rifle. She used Phil and Cindy's story about the state taking away Nash to get Mr. Brennan to trust her. Brody backed away, while Bess urged Phil to shoot him. Brody tried to dissuade Phil from making a huge mistake, but Cindy came up behind him and knocked him out with a vase. While Cindy was checking on him, Bess suddenly reverted to Jessica.

Stacy told Stan that she'd give him the money if he agreed to punch her. She even handed him a pair of leather gloves, promising that there'd be no evidence to connect him to the assault. Afterward, she immediately had a shiner around her eye. Stan walked off with the money, but told her she always has a job in Vegas. Stacy claimed that she had moved on with her life.

Schuyler, Rex and Gigi continued their conversation in the park, where Rex accused Schuyler of stealing Stacy's money. When Rex returned home, he noticed that Stacy seemed upset and asked her to tell him what's going on. When she turned around, he immediately saw the black eye and asked who did that to her. She told a whole long story about Stan's threats. Rex assumed that Stan had seen him with Gigi at the park and immediately blamed himself for Stan attacking her. She managed to get Rex to give her a massage, and it was clear that he was playing right into her hands.

Back at Schuyler's, he and Gigi lamented that Stacy and Rex are not acting like the people they fell in love with, respectively. Schuyler checked the refrigerator and noticed that Stacy's blood samples were missing. Gigi started to wonder if Schuyler was making this whole thing up. He assured her that he wasn't, and guessed that Stacy (the only person other than Roxy who has keys) took the bag of blood. Gigi apologized for doubting him, then wondered who really did save her child's life.

Starr asked Cole why he was so quiet. He said he was happy to hear the news about Hope and would be in touch after his drug test. Starr sat in the foyer wringing her hands, while Michael and Marcie waited in the living room with John and Todd for word of Hope's whereabouts. As Blair and Starr recalled the day Hope was born, Todd overheard Starr say that she wished her dad was there for her that day. Meanwhile, Todd managed to make Marcie and Michael feel so uncomfortable that they decided to wait at home. As soon as they were gone, Todd got up to go see Té, but Blair suggested that he stay. Starr expressed her confusion over the situation but said she didn't blame Todd for what happened with the baby switch. Back at the Angel Square Hotel, Michael was elated but Marcie wondered if the news about Hope was a good thing.

Marty accompanied Cole to the rehab center for his drug test. During a private chat with Rachel, he revealed what he'd just learned about his baby and admitted to being concerned about who would raise Hope if she returned. Marty ran into John in the parking lot and asked if he has an answer to her question, but he didn't. He gave her some comforting words about Cole, while Rachel challenged Cole to admit what he really wants for Hope.

Jessica rushed to an unconscious Brody's side and showed genuine concern for the boyfriend she wanted to get rid of five minutes earlier. When the Brennans realized that Jessica didn't even know her they were, they began to call the hotline, but Bess prevailed. After cutting the phone line, she grabbed the baby and wished them well. Just as she was about to walk out the door, however, police swarmed the house.
